And so we concocted this slightly simpler ramen-in-a-jar recipe that's perfect for taking to work or on other kinds of outings. The great thing about ramen is that you can customize it in a thousand different ways. You really can use whatever veggies you have on hand. I had some canned baby corn in the pantry, so I added that, and I think water chestnuts might also be fun.


Depending on how fancy you want to take it, this recipe can be made in as little as 10 minutes. You could make four jars to have lunches all week, or make a quick no-mess meal for the family.


Ingredients:

  • 4 pint-and-a-half, wide-mouth Azure Canning Co. jars (NF824)

  • 4 Tbsp chili garlic sauce (CO865)

  • 4 Tbsp Azure Market Organics coconut aminos (CO942)

  • 2 tsp grated ginger (QP162)

  • 1 package Lotus Foods Organic Jade Pearl Rice Ramen Noodles (GY1028) (each package contains 4 cakes)

  • 2 tsp garlic, diced (QP324)

  • 2-3 carrots, shredded (QP165)

  • 1/2 cup spring onion or leeks (QP262), sliced

  • 1 pack Gimme Roasted Seaweed Snack, Sea Salt, Organic (SN759)

  • 1 quart liquid chicken broth (GY058)




Optional:

  • tofu cubes or egg

  • green peas or edamame

  • diced bell pepper (about 2 diced)

  • leftover chicken or beef or rotisserie chicken (2 cups)

  • bok choy or other thinly sliced greens (2 cups)

  • mushrooms or baby corn

  • sliced lime

  • Substitute 4 tsp broth powder (QS017) plus 1 quart boiling water for liquid broth



Directions:

Gather four Azure Canning Company pint-and-a-half jars with lids. Add one-fourth of the chili garlic sauce, coconut aminos, ginger, and garlic to each jar. Add veggies, and the optional cooked chicken/tofu/other protein, distributing evenly between the jars. Add one ramen cake per jar, breaking into pieces if necessary.


Store with an airtight lid until you’re ready to eat. Lasts 4–5 days in the fridge.


When ready to serve, boil the chicken broth and pour it into the jars. Fill the jars to the top and cover with a lid. (If you need more broth, just add boiling water to fill.) Let the noodles sit in the broth for 5 minutes before eating. Top with seaweed snack sheets, torn into bite-sized pieces. Stir and enjoy!


A note about Lotus Foods Rice Noodles:

These Japanese-style noodles are made from specialty rice instead of wheat. In addition to being gluten-free, Jade Pearl Rice is infused with chlorophyll-rich, wild-crafted bamboo extract. It's ready to eat in just 4 minutes! Add to soup or miso for a quick bowl of flavorful and nourishing noodles any time.
